A few years ago I was a project manager on a records management contract
at the US Dept. of Justice. We had 50 people on the project managing
litigation case files. Many were commonly called "clerks".  In
Washington, of course, the first thing anybody asks you is: "What do you
do", or "Where do you work?" I told my people not to introduce
themselves as "clerks", but as "information management professionals".
Here in DC, that could be especially important in social situations with
"potential". Never got any feedback on that one. I'll leave it there.
